The Wardens of the Black Gate were a specialized Deathwatch contingent tasked with holding the line against the most relentless xenos incursions, a splinter left over from a larger Tyranid hive fleet. The Black Gate refers to an important trade hub where multiple reliable warp lanes converge.
Doctrine and Role
[edit | edit source]The Wardens were formed to provide heavy infantry tactics, favouring Gravis-armored Veterans and terminators, equipped with heavy bolters, Cyclone missile launchers, and frag cannons. Their combat doctrine emphasizes:
- Zone denial and attrition warfare
- Siege-breaking and fortress defense
- Counter-xenos suppression in confined environments
Recruitment and Composition
[edit | edit source]The Wardens draw heavily from Chapters known for resilience and firepower:
- Minotaurs — brutal enforcers with a taste for shock assault
- Iron Hands — cybernetic warriors who endure beyond flesh
- Imperial Fists — masters of siege warfare
- Salamanders — flame-wielding protectors with a strong sense of duty
